Step by Step: Navigating the Classic Inca Trail to Reach Machu Picchu

Classic Inca Trail

Embarking on the Classic Inca Trail or the Salkantay Trek to Machu Picchu is a lifetime journey. These iconic treks promise a blend of history, culture, and breathtaking scenery that culminates in the awe-inspiring sight of the ancient Incan citadel. In this guide, we’ll take you through the step-by-step process of navigating the Classic Inca Trail, providing valuable insights for a seamless and memorable adventure.

1. Planning and Preparation:

Before embarking on the Classic Inca Trail or the Salkantay Trek, thorough planning is essential. Secure necessary permits, choose a reputable tour operator and ensure you’re physically prepared for the trek’s demands.

2. Day-by-Day Itinerary:

Both treks offer multi-day journeys through diverse landscapes. The Classic Inca Trail spans four days, taking you through ancient ruins, cloud forests, and high mountain passes. The Salkantay Trek, on the other hand, covers five days, leading you from high-altitude terrains to lush rainforests.

3. Acclimatization:

As both treks involve high altitudes, proper acclimatization is crucial. Spend a few days in Cusco before the trek to adjust to the altitude and reduce the risk of altitude sickness.

4. Guided Exploration:

Both treks are typically conducted with experienced guides who are well-versed in the trails, history, and culture of the region. They provide invaluable insights, ensuring you get the most out of your trekking experience.

5. Camping and Accommodation:

The Classic Inca Trail involves camping at designated sites along the route. The Salkantay Trek offers a mix of camping and lodges. It’s important to choose the trek that aligns with your comfort preferences.

6. Nourishment and Hydration:

Proper nutrition and hydration are vital during the trek. Guides will often provide nourishing meals, and it’s important to carry sufficient water to stay hydrated, especially at high altitudes.

7. Witnessing Incan Ruins:

Both treks lead you through ancient Incan sites, allowing you to marvel at the architectural marvels and gain a deeper understanding of the Incan civilization.

8. Capturing the Journey:

Both treks offer breathtaking vistas and opportunities for awe-inspiring photographs. Don’t forget to capture the memories and the stunning natural beauty of the Andean landscape.

9. The Final Ascent:

The culmination of both treks is the arrival at Machu Picchu. Whether through the Sun Gate on the Classic Inca Trail or via the final leg on the Salkantay Trek, the sight of this ancient citadel is a moment that will forever be etched in your memory.
